Frappe Betterprint Docs
  • Frappe Betterprint Docs
  • About Frappe Betterprint
  • Installation & Setup
  • Quick-start Guide
  • Features
    • Dynamic Header & Footer
    • Betterprint-specific Jinja examples
Powered by GitBook
On this page
  • Why another Print solution for Frappe?
  • How is Betterprint working under the hood?
  • Who's behind Frappe Betterprint?
  • Contact

About Frappe Betterprint

Get to know more about Frappe Betterprint...

PreviousFrappe Betterprint DocsNextInstallation & Setup

Last updated 1 month ago

Why another Print solution for Frappe?

When we first considered Frappe Framework for our company, Print Formats have been quite limited. wkhtmltopdf isn't maintained anymore and frappe_pdff as well as Print Designer is still somewhere limited for specific needs. This lead us to the decision to develop a better solution.

Frappe Betterprint is OpenSource and

How is Betterprint working under the hood?

Frappe Betterprint is heavily relying on an extended version of , which renders the html content into pages. This library has solely been developed for Frappe Betterprint. Besides this library, Betterprint is relying on to control a headless, chromium based browser and create PDF files.

Who's behind Frappe Betterprint?

Frappe Betterprint has been developed & is maintained by , a Company located in Switzerland.

Contact

Have you found any security concerns or urgent need? Feel free to contact us:

info@neocode.ch

available on Github - Contributions are Welcome!
paginate.js
Playwright python
Neocode.ch